In this study a multi-objective optimization workflow has been developed: to reduce wiper system reversal noise by system optimization; to investigate cause-effect relationships by sensitivity analysis; to investigate robustness of proposed solutions. The workflow consists of three parts: a first part where the wiper system input influencing factors are considered; a second part where the wiper system reversal noise is evaluated for the given inputs; a final part where an optimization loop minimizes the wiper system reversal noise with respect to the given input parameter and within the given constraints. The presented workflow is applied for the development of low noise wiper rubber profiles. This study presented an application case where the wiper system reversal noise is reduced by a mechatronic approach, i.e. by using the Bosch new generation wiper drive electronics to ensure a reversal noise optimized wiping movement.
